Hmm.  The ECUSA (Episcopal Church in the US of A)=20
has lost 2/3 of its membership over the past=20
forty years.  Most of those drifting away well,=20
just drifted.  Some did become Catholic or=20
Orthodox or Baptist or, probably, Ba'hai, but,=20
for the most part, most folks just drifted off in=20
refusal to accept the meaningless and rushed=20
changes forced on the liturgy and hierarchy of=20
the Church and most have just been sitting around rather dazed by it all.
